And Now, Titans Coach Jeff Fisher Also Hates Lane Kiffin

Hating USC football coach Lane Kiffin is a popular thing to do these days, and it just got even more so: Kiffin hired Tennessee Titans running backs coach Kennedy Pola away to USC, and Titans coach Jeff Fisher feels wronged by his alma mater.

Fisher didn’t think Kiffin handled the process fairly, and aired his grievances to The Tennesseean:

“I am very disappointed in Lane Kiffin’s approach to this,’’ Fisher said. “Typically speaking when coaches are interested in hiring or discussing potential employment from coaches on respective staffs there is a courtesy call made from the head coach or athletic director indicating there is an interest in talking to the assistant.

“So I am very disappointed in the lack of professionalism on behalf of Lane, to call me and leave me a voice mail after Kennedy had informed me he had taken the job. It is just a lack of professionalism.’’

Strong words, to which Kiffin responded a short time ago:

“We reached out to Kennedy Pola yesterday to gauge whether he had any possible interest in returning to USC before we moved forward with the process,” Kiffin said in a statement released by USC.

“Kennedy said he would think about it and get back to us today. Once Kennedy did call back earlier today, out of my great respect for Coach Fisher I immediately reached out to Coach to make him aware of the situation.

“I have spoken with Coach Fisher and he now has an accurate understanding of the timeline of events.

Call us crazy, but we don’t see anything there suggesting that Fisher ever had an inaccurate understanding. The important thing isn’t that Kiffin’s response was “immediate” after Pola made up his mind…it’s that he didn’t contact Fisher before speaking with Pola.

It’s no surprise that many media outlets are having their fun with Kiffin pissing off even more people, but that’s warranted. Kiffin’s ability to get people to despise him is truly amazing, and he seems to work at it like it’s an art form.

Feuding with Al Davis, criticizing Urban Meyer under false pretenses, leaving Tennessee after one year, and now shady hiring practices – if anything, Kiffin thrives on getting under people’s skin. He is coaching’s answer to internet trolls, and those he offends might want to adopt a common strategy used on such trolls and just ignore him. He can’t feed off of attention that isn’t there.
